Document Description
The project is at 2 locations in Silverwood Lake. The first location is at Live Oak Landing on the east side of the lake. At this location, the 8 existing shade structures will be replaced with new ones. At Chamise, the second location, ADA accessible pathways will be installed. The California Natural Diversity Database and the U.S. Fish and Wildlife website has been researched and no threatened or endangered species will be affected by the project.

Notice of Exemption

Exempt Status
Categorical Exemption
Type, Section or Code
15302, 15311
Reasons for Exemption
Project is a replacement of existing structures and construction of a minor structure that is an accessory to existing facilities.
